Output c69fd29f997152453d6fe7568f2ebe5feefbfc24f3eb68d2cbd9357b47e86f7f:2

value
26348642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01857d51c35cb4737f002d70dd62c0ecffc12c12 OP_EQUAL
address
31q4WkVShN1hjPvVEbyvRwJ1DGMkMaURfB
transaction
c69fd29f997152453d6fe7568f2ebe5feefbfc24f3eb68d2cbd9357b47e86f7f
spent
true